Dear maintainer(s),

The Release Team considers packages that are out-of-sync between testing and =
unstable for more than 30 days as having a Release Critical bug in testing [1=
]. Your package src:node-yarnpkg has been trying to migrate for 36 days [2], =
hence this bug report. The current output of the migration software for this =
package is copied to the bottom of this report and should list the reason why=
 the package is blocked.

If a package is out of sync between unstable and testing for a longer period,=
 this usually means that bugs in the package in testing cannot be fixed via u=
nstable. Blocked packages can have impact on other packages, which makes prep=
aring for the release more difficult. The situation that caused this bug repo=
rt might even be the result of such an issue. We expect maintainers to fix is=
sues that hamper the migration of their package in a timely manner. If your p=
ackage in this situation due to another package, consider helping out.

This bug will trigger auto-removal when appropriate. As with all new bugs, th=
ere will be at least 30 days before the package is auto-removed.

This bug submission immediately closes the bug with the version in unstable, =
so if that version or a later version migrates, this bug will no longer affec=
t testing. This bug is also tagged to only affect sid and forky, so it doesn'=
t affect (old-)stable.

If you believe your package is unable to migrate to testing due to issues bey=
ond your control, don't hesitate to contact the Release Team.
